Container vessel struck by ‘projectile’ near Jebel Ali | Ship Accidents

Container vessel, Source Blessing, was struck by an unknown projectile while sailing approximately 35 nautical miles north of Jebel Ali, UAE, on March 12, according to reports from claims specialist WK Webster.

The 40478-dwt ship (2003-built) sustained a fire in the engine room, which was subsequently brought under control and has now been extinguished.

There are currently no reports of injuries or casualties.

Additional information from UKMTO indicated that the container ship was struck by unknown projectile causing a small fire onboard.

All crew members were reported safe, and authorities said no environmental pollution has been detected.

According to United Kingdom Maritime Trade Operations (UKMTO) reports from the master, the incident took place 35 nautical miles north of Jebel Ali, United Arab Emirates.

The UKMTO urged vessels in the area to transit with caution and report any suspicious activity while authorities continue to investigate.

UKMTO didn’t disclose the name of the vessel in its report on Thursday.
